element tested, plus the percent of ash in the coal. The primary elements are C, H, O, N and S. The ash is the noncombustible portion of the coal. There are other elements present in lesser quantities, some of which are hazardous, such as Cl, V, and Hg, but the "CHONS" are the important elements for combustion calculations.

The BTM is a low-speed mill that primarily grinds coal by impact and attrition. The VRM is a medium- speed mill that grinds coal by compression and, because of the low coal inventory in the mill and flat grinding surfaces, develops shearing action as well. To summarize the coal mill controls, they may be divided basically into two major categories:. 1. To control the quality of coal being sent to the burners located on the furnace walls. The word quality here means the temperature and fineness of the PF. The set temperature values are dependent on the percentage of volatile matter that exists in the main fuel.

Trace elements are present in coal ash because the parent coal from which the ash is derived also contains trace elements . as a result of natural formation processes. During combustion, most trace elements in the parent coal are retained in the residual coal ash and are concentrated in the smaller volume of the ash compared to the original ...
